Using Narratives to Correct Forecasting Errors in Pediatric Tracheostomy Decision Making.

Haoyang YanPatricia J DeldinStephanie K KukoraCynthia Arslanian-EngorenKenneth PituchBrian J Zikmund-Fisher
Published in: Medical decision making : an international journal of the Society for Medical Decision Making (2021)
Narratives clarifying long-term implications of pursuing tracheostomy have the potential to influence forecasting and decisions. Narrative-based interventions may be valuable in other situations in which forecasting errors are common.
